There are over 300 sculptures in Middelheim Openluchtmuseum (open air museum), a 67-acre sculpture garden in the Nachtegalen (nightingale) park in Antwerp. In addition to modern pieces like those above, the park also has some classical works...
...including an original Auguste Rodin:
